Step 1: Initial Setup and Installation

Begin by safely disabling your backhoe loader. Lower all attachments to the ground, engage the parking brake, and disconnect the battery ground cable. Drain the hydraulic oil from the system to prevent spills. Remove the old pump by disconnecting the hydraulic lines, unbolting it from the timing gear cover, and carefully pulling it straight out. Clean the mounting surface thoroughly to ensure a proper seal. Install your new hydraulic gear pump for John Deere 410G by aligning the drive gear with the engine timing gear, pushing it into place, and torquing the mounting bolts to factory specifications. Reconnect all hydraulic lines using new seals.

Step 2: First-Time User Guide

After installation, fill the hydraulic reservoir with the recommended grade of oil. Start the engine and let it idle for a few minutes while watching for leaks. Slowly cycle the loader and backhoe controls to purge air from the system. You will notice the pump has a distinct sound difference compared to a worn unit—quieter and more consistent. Operate the machine through a full range of motion to check for smooth function.

Step 5: Maintenance and Care

Inspect the pump and lines weekly for signs of leaks or damage. Regularly change the hydraulic filter and oil per your John Deere service schedule. Keep the exterior of the pump clean to prevent dirt from damaging the seals. If you store the machine for extended periods, run it periodically to keep the seals lubricated.

Step 6: Troubleshooting Common Issues

If you experience low pressure after installation, check for air in the system or a clogged suction line. If the pump is noisy, verify that the mounting bolts are tight and the drive gear is properly aligned. For persistent issues, refer to our hydraulic pump troubleshooting guide. Expert Tips for Maximum Value

Tip #1: Use New Seals

Always install new O-rings and shaft seals when replacing the pump. This prevents future leaks and ensures a proper seal. The cost is minimal compared to the labor of redoing the job.

Tip #2: Prime the Pump

Before starting the engine, fill the pump cavity with clean hydraulic oil. This prevents dry start wear and helps the pump build pressure faster on first startup.

Tip #3: Upgrade Your Hydraulic Oil

Use a full synthetic hydraulic oil with a high viscosity index. This improves performance in extreme temperatures and extends pump life. Pair your new pump with AT180926 hydraulic pump for backhoe loader grade components.

Tip #4: Check Alignment

Ensure the pump drive gear engages properly with the engine timing gear. Misalignment can cause excessive noise and premature pump failure.

Tip #5: Monitor Oil Temperature

If your machine runs hot, install an inline oil cooler. High temperatures degrade oil and accelerate pump wear.

Tip #6: Change Filters Frequently

Replace the hydraulic filter at the same time you swap the pump. A clean filter reduces contamination and protects your investment.

Tip #7: Torque Bolts Correctly

Use a torque wrench to tighten pump mounting bolts to John Deere specifications. Overtightening can distort the housing, while undertightening can cause leaks.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  1. Mistake: Reusing old hydraulic fluid after pump replacement. Solution: Always drain and replace the hydraulic oil to prevent circulating debris that can damage your new pump.
  2. Mistake: Not purging air from the system properly. Solution: Cycle the controls slowly and allow the pump to self-prime before demanding full pressure. Air trapped in the system can cause cavitation.
  3. Mistake: Ignoring small leaks during installation. Solution: Tighten all connections immediately. Small drips can become large problems that starve the pump of fluid.
  4. Mistake: Using the wrong viscosity oil. Solution: Check your machines manual and use the recommended grade. Too thick or too thin oil will reduce pump efficiency and lifespan.
  5. Mistake: Forgetting to clean the mounting surface. Solution: Remove all old gasket material and dirt. Any debris can create a gap that leads to misalignment and oil leaks.

How long does this pump typically last?

Lifespan depends heavily on maintenance and operating conditions. With proper care, including clean oil and regular filter changes, you can reasonably expect 3,000 to 5,000 hours of service life. Harsh conditions like extreme dust or high temperatures may shorten that.
